3 premium ski regions with one card! Or: 1 ticket. 3 regions. ∞ mountains. With the ticket association of the Skicircus Saalbach Hinterglemm Leogang Fieberbrunn with the Schmittenhöhe in Zell am See and the Kitzsteinhorn Kaprun glacier ski area, the Ski ALPIN CARD opens up 408 perfectly groomed kilometers of slopes, 121 ultra-modern facilities and thus a national alpine offer to its guests. The Ski ALPIN CARD is issued as a day, multi-day or season ticket. And as a non-skier or boarder? Austria's winter landscape can also be enjoyed intensely away from the slopes.
